2016 Axys 800.

If riding on a trail with a little load on the motor and temps below 125, there is a constant engine stumble in the RPM range of 4700-5000 (colder the temp, the more severe of the stumble). Now if the temp is over 135 there is absolutely no stumble.
If the trail is on a incline and there is load on the motor there is absolutely no stumble.

New ECU flash from BD did not help, exhaust valves were cleaned, new spark plugs.

I'm assuming it's running rich in that 4700-5000 range when it stumbles.

Ideas, suggestions??
